Twonkie
/twon’kee/ The software equivalent of a Twinkie (a variety of sugar-loaded junk food, or (in gay slang) the male equivalent of “chick”); a useless “feature” added to look sexy and placate a marketroid.
Compare Saturday-night special.
The term may also be related to “The Twonky”, title menace of a classic SF short story by Lewis Padgett (Henry Kuttner and C. L. Moore), first published in the September 1942 “Astounding Science Fiction” and subsequently much anthologised.
